What does Corita mean?
[ syll. co-ri-ta, cor-ita ] The baby girl name Corita is pronounced as KAOerIYTAH †. Corita is of Old Greek and Old Norse origin.
Corita is a variation of Cora (English and French).
Corita is also a variation of Corey (English).
See also the related category greek.
Corita is not often used as a baby girl name. It is listed outside of the top 1000. Among the family of girl names directly related to Corita, Cora was the most frequently used in 2018.
